Özet

Fast production of ZnO nanorods was obtained by bottom up approach using arc discharge in de-ionized water method. XRD shows the ZnO nanorods crystallize in the hexagonal wurtzite structure and exhibit (101) preferential orientation, with a calculated mean grain size of approximately 30 nm. TEM analysis shows well-crystallized nanorod morphology with a diameter ranging from 10 to 30 nm and the length varied from 50 to 100 nm. In addition, TEM shows the presence of 10 nm diameter rodlike nanoparticles. The ZnO nanorod growth have been empirically based on these results. © 2011, Advanced Engineering Solutions.
